Academic Listening Encounters: Life in Society Student's Book with Audio CD: Listening, Note Taking, and Discussion by Kim Sanabria (City University of New York)

The Academic Encounters series uses a sustained content approach to teach skills necessary for taking academic courses in English. There are two books for each content area. Academic Listening Encounters: Life in Society engages students through interviews and academic lectures on stimulating topics from the field of sociology. Topics include culture shock, gender roles, and ways of solving crime. Students practice crucial listening skills, such as listening for main ideas and details and listening for signal words. They also practice note-taking skills, discuss content, conduct interviews, and make presentations. A Student Audio CD with the lecture portion of the audio program is included. Topics correspond with those in Academic Encounters: American Studies. The books may be used independently or together.

Table of Contents

Unit 1. Belonging to a Group: 1. Marriage, family, and the home; 2. The power of the group; Unit 2. Gender and Sexuality: 3. Growing up male or female; 4. Gender issues today; Unit 3. Media and Society: 5. Mass media today; 6. The influence of the media; Unit 4. Breaking the Rules: 7. Crime and criminals; 8. Controlling crime; Unit 5. Changing Societies: 9. Cultural variation and change; 10. Global issues
